Ticket: Drift on Cartwheel tile prefetcher

So the prefetcher on the east pool is hammering the tile store way harder than west — looks like someone bumped the prefetch radius during the festival-weekend crunch and never rolled it back. Cache hit rate is fine, but storage egress costs are not. Please restore the baseline tonight. For comparison, east currently runs with these values.

config for hahip-kaguf:
[holath]
port = 8443
region = north-4
host = holath.tolvaqlabs.internal
timeout_ms = 1000
retries = 2

New folks: request tracing in the Larkspur mesh depends on every service sharing identical propagation settings. They've drifted. Three services still emit legacy span headers; two sample at 100% and are hammering the collector. Symptoms: broken traces between checkout and ledger, missing parent spans. Fix is to align all services with the canonical baseline, then redeploy in dependency order. Do not hand-edit per-service overrides. The canonical tracing configuration every service must match is as follows.

service settings:
[oliix]
team = noveth
access_code = ac_4de949
host = oliix.novachq.corp
port = 8080
owner = wenir.casion
peer = wenys.lumicstack.corp

Hi Dorin,

The cutover of the Shelfwright import pipeline completed at 02:40 as planned. All 118,402 records from the Vellum City branch catalogue landed without checksum mismatches; the two flagged duplicates were resolved manually by Petra before the final pass. Rollback snapshots were retained and will be pruned after the seven-day window. Downstream search reindexing finished ahead of schedule. For your release notes, please record the configuration the importer ran with, reproduced in full below.

settings of yageg-yahap:
[gorael]
team = olieth
access_code = ac_941d74
owner = brieth.aldiel
host = gorael.tolvaqio.internal
port = 6379
peer = briwyn.urlaqtech.internal
salt = 116e6622
pin = 1957